Title :
Analysis of switching regulators by phase portrait technique

Abstract :
The phase portrait technique is used to analyze transient and steady-state operation of switching regulators. The regulator model and analysis procedure are established, treatment of circuit nonlinearities, its time varying nature and feedback configuration is included. The proposed technique is applied to the analysis of buck converter operation. The benefits of analysis are discussed in view of understanding the switching regulator operation.
